Definitions:

Phagocytic Cell

A type of immune cell capable of engulfing and absorbing bacteria, other foreign bodies, and sometimes dead cells.

Macrophage

A macrophage is a type of white blood cell part of the immune system, capable of phagocytosis, engulfing and digesting cellular debris, foreign substances, microbes, and cancer cells.

Centrioles

Cylinder-shaped organelles found in the cells of animals and most algae that help in the organization of spindle fibers during cell division.

Intracellular Digestion

A metabolic process where cells break down nutrients within their internal structures, such as lysosomes, to obtain energy and building blocks.
